What to Expect

Players take on the role of ancient Pharaohs expanding the Temple of Amun-Ra on the Nile's eastern bank. The game board features six sections tied to Egyptian gods and a central obelisk that casts shifting shadows. Over multiple rounds, players draft colored dice with values affected by the obelisk's shadow, classified as Pure, Tainted, or Forbidden. The sun's rotation changes available actions, requiring tactical dice selection and planning.

How It Works

Each round, players draft dice from different board sections, each enabling specific actions. Central mechanics include Action Drafting, Turn Order based on stats, and Pattern Building. The color and value of dice are influenced by the obelisk's shadow, which changes each round, affecting dice availability and strategic choices.

What Makes It Special

Designed by Daniele Tascini and Dávid Turczi, Tekhenu was nominated in 2020 for the Cardboard Republic Tactician Laurel and Golden Geek Heavy Game of the Year. Its unique combination of dice drafting with a dynamic shadow mechanic sets it apart, within the Ancient: Egypt family of games.
